Cement Mixer Wagons[]

Cement Mixer Wagons are specialised wagons with large drums for mixing concrete.

Technical Details[]

Liveries[]

In the Wooden Railway range, the cement mixer is painted maroon with black wheels. Its drum is painted yellow with black hazard stripes around the middle and "SODOR" written at one end in black lettering.

In the Take-n-Play range, the cement mixer is painted blue with black wheels. Its running board is orange with black hazard stripes along the sides. Its drum is painted yellow with black hazard stripes around the middle and "SODOR CEMENT" written at one end in black lettering.

Cargo Cranes[]

Cargo Cranes are rail-based cranes used for unloading goods. There are two of these cranes: one used by Sodor Ice Delivery, and the other by the Sodor Shipping Company.

Technical Details[]

Basis[]

The cargo cranes are based on a Cowans Sheldon 30 ton breakdown crane with two additional smokestacks behind the cab.

Liveries[]

The Sodor Ice Delivery crane is painted white with a blue chassis and black wheels. Its roof and smokestacks are painted silver. There is a small yellow label reading "CAUTION" underneath the crane arm, as well as a section with yellow and black hazard stripes behind the cab. The words "SODOR ICE DELIVERY" are painted along the sides of the chassis on both sides in dark blue with a white outline.

The Sodor Shipping Company crane is painted dark green with black smokestacks and wheels. It chassis is painted with yellow and black hazard stripes, with its number (81978) at the front of each side. The words "SODOR SHIPPING CO." are painted on the sides of its match wagon in black and the ends in white. Its crane arm is grey.

Trivia[]

  • The two smokestacks on the back of the cranes are made of die-cast metal to keep the cranes upright when their arms are extended.

The Fire Train[]

The Fire Train is a breakdown crane converted to help put out fires.

Technical Details[]

Basis[]

The fire train is based on a Cowans Sheldon 30 ton breakdown crane with an added water cannon in place of the crane arm.

Livery[]

The fire train is painted red with yellow window frames. The words "SODOR FIRE DEPT. NO. 36" are written on each side in yellow lettering with a black drop shadow.

Trivia[]

  • The hose on the fire engine that the fire train comes with is detachable and can be attached to the fire train itself.
  • The 2006 iterations of the fire station, fire truck, and fire train were recalled for lead paint in 2007.
